Which of the following actions can help nurses avoid being liable for negligence?(Select All that Apply.)
Developing a caring rapport with clients
Failing to notify the provider of a change in the client's condition
Following standards of care
Communicate effectively with other health team members
Fully documenting assessments, interventions, and evaluations
Failing to document care provided
Ignoring facility policies and procedures
Correct Answer : A,C,D,E
A. Developing a caring rapport with clients is correct. Building a strong, trusting relationship with clients can help reduce the likelihood of miscommunication or misunderstandings, which could lead to negligence. A caring rapport promotes effective communication and patient satisfaction.
B. Failing to notify the provider of a change in the client's condition is incorrect. Failing to notify the provider when a client's condition changes is an example of negligence. Nurses must report any changes in the patient's condition promptly to prevent harm.
C. Following standards of care is correct. Adhering to established standards of care is essential to ensure that the nurse provides safe and competent care. Deviating from these standards can lead to negligence and potential liability.
D. Communicate effectively with other health team members is correct. Effective communication among healthcare team members helps ensure that everyone is informed about the patient's condition and care plan. Poor communication is a common cause of medical errors and negligence.
E. Fully documenting assessments, interventions, and evaluations is correct. Proper documentation is a legal record of the care provided. Thorough, accurate documentation helps protect nurses from liability and serves as evidence of care in the event of a legal dispute.
F. Failing to document care provided is incorrect. Failure to document the care provided is a form of negligence. Documentation is essential for patient safety and for providing a clear, detailed record of care, which protects both the nurse and the patient.
G. Ignoring facility policies and procedures is incorrect. Ignoring facility policies and procedures increases the risk of negligence and potential harm to patients. Policies and procedures are put in place to ensure the delivery of safe and effective care, and failure to follow them could lead to liability.
